2016-06-17 2 views
0

excelセルからvbコードにパスを渡すにはどうすればいいですか?そこからファイルを選択して処理しますか?どのようにExcelのセルからVBコードにパスを渡すには?

パスを明示的に指定しているところで、以下のコードを使用しています。代わりに、私はそれをExcelのセルから取る必要があります。

enter image description here

+0

ようこそStackOverflowへ。 [良い質問をするにはどうすればよいですか](http://stackoverflow.com/help/how-to-ask)のヘルプトピックをお読みください。また、ツアー中に(http://stackoverflow.com/tour)、バッジを獲得することもできます。その後、コードの画像を削除し、VBAコード自体をあなたの投稿にコピーしてください。 – Ralph

+1

こんにちはKavya、あなたのコードをテキストとして貼り付けた方がいいでしょう。 –

答えて

0

MyPathが文字列であることを示すために、あなたの変数宣言を更新します。
Dim MyPath as String(このビットは必須ではないが、それは良い習慣です)。

次に、セルにポイントするだけです。MyPath = myWb.Worksheets("Sheet1").Range("A1")

関連する問題